Tioga County Pa. Special Olympics holds annual track and field competition
MANSFIELD, Pa. (WETM) – Tioga County Pennsylvania Special Olympics held its annual track and field competition today in Mansfield. The competition took place at the Karl Van Norman Field on Commonwealth University Mansfield’s campus on Friday, May 31. Elmira City Council to vote on fixing two elevators at Centertown Garage
ELMIRA, N.Y. (WETM) – On Monday the Elmira City Council will vote on funding to fix two of the three broken elevators at the Centertown Parking Garage downtown.
